[[http://www.uniprot.org/uniprot/XA2_DEIAC XA2_DEIAC]] Anticoagulant protein which binds to the gamma-carboxyglutamic acid-domain regions of factors IX and factor X in the presence of calcium with a 1 to 1 stoichiometry. Also inhibits platelet aggregation by binding to platelet glycoprotein Ibalpha (GP1BA) and functioning as a blocker of vWF. Is devoid of hemorrhagic and lethal activities. Possess antithrombotic and thrombolytic activities. Also hydrolyzes the Aalpha-chain of fibrinogen. Does not affect the Bbeta-chain and the gamma chain (By similarity).<ref>PMID:12175618</ref> [[http://www.uniprot.org/uniprot/XB2_DEIAC XB2_DEIAC]] Anticoagulant protein which binds to the gamma-carboxyglutamic acid-domain regions of factors IX and factor X in the presence of calcium with a 1 to 1 stoichiometry.
